Despite what Granlund has accomplished at the NHL level thus far(or lack there of), by the end of his 19 year old season he had two PPG SM-Liiga seasons, including being the leading scorer in the playoffs for the SM-Liiga champions HIFK, and was point per game (tied for 3rd in Tourney for Points) for the Gold Medal winning Finland at the World Championships.

He hasn't lived up to the hype in the NHL, but few recent prospects had better resumes leading to the hype. He was basically a consensus top 5 prospect(often fighting Tarsenko for 1) by the time he turned 20.

No one can deny Granlund's skill but many people suspected that he'd have difficulty replicating those results in the NHL because of his sub-par skating.
While he's improved somewhat in that area, its still the case.
Speed/agility/skating are some of Nylanders greatest assets and that's a reason why he has transitioned so well
